August 11
Events
2492 BC - Traditional date of the defeat of Bel by Hayk , progenitor and founder of the Armenian nation.
480 BC - Greco-Persian Wars : Battle of Artemisium - The Persians achieve a naval victory over the Greeks in an engagement fought near Artemisium , a promontory on the north coast of Euboea . The Greek fleet holds its own against the Persians in three days of fighting but withdraws southward when news comes of the defeat at Thermopylae .
355 - Claudius Silvanus , accused of treason, proclaims himself Roman Emperor against Constantius II .
1786 - Captain Francis Light established the British colony of Penang in Malaysia
1804 - Francis II assumed title of first Emperor of Austria
1858 - First ascent of the Eiger .
1898 - Spanish-American War : American troops enter the city of Mayagüez , Puerto Rico .
1918 - World War I - Battle of Amiens ends
1919 - Constitution of Weimar Republic adopted
1920 - The Latvia -Bolshevist Russia peace treaty, which relinquished Russia's authority and pretenses to Latvia, is signed.
1929 - Babe Ruth becomes the first baseball player to hit 500 home runs in his career with a home run at League Park in Cleveland, Ohio .
1934 - Federal prison opened at Alcatraz Island.
1952 - Hussein proclaimed king of Jordan
1960 - Chad declares independence.
1965 - Race riots (the Watts riots ) begin in Watts area of Los Angeles, California .
1968 - The last steam passenger train service runs in Britain. A selection of British Rail steam locomotives make the 120-mile journey from Liverpool to Carlisle and returns to Liverpool before having their fires dropped for the last time - this working was known as the Fifteen Guinea Special .
1972 - Vietnam War : The last United States ground combat unit depart South Vietnam .
1975 - East Timor : Governor Mário Lemos Pires of Portuguese Timor abandons the capital Dili , following a coup by the Timorese Democratic Union (UDT) and the outbreak of civil war between UDT and Fretilin .
1999 - The exceptional Salt Lake City Tornado tears through the downtown district of the city, killing one.
2003 - NATO takes over command of the peacekeeping force in Afghanistan , marking its first major operation outside Europe in its 54-year-history.
2003 - Jemaah Islamiyah leader Riduan Isamuddin, better known as Hambali , is arrested in Bangkok , Thailand .
2003 - A heat wave in Paris resulted in temperatures rising to 112°F (44° C ), leaving about 144 people dead.
